About The Position

Municipal Management Services, Inc., has an immediate opening for a Full-time Permit Clerk. This role performs a variety of duties in support of the Building Department. The Permit Clerk coordinates the issuance of various permits for the Village, including greeting applicants, explaining procedures for acquiring permits to the public, and receiving payments for permits.

Responsibilities

  • Issue building and other applicable permits, licenses and certificates of occupancy within the Building Department.
  • Provide information and documents to contractors, developers, general public and other parties related to building and development within the Village.
  • Answers the telephone and transfers callers to appropriate parties; responds to questions and requests for information regarding fees, codes, and permits.
  • Prepare inspection schedules; review permit applications.
  • Calculate permit and impact fees; receive money for permits; reconcile the cash drawer daily.
  • Perform a wide variety of general clerical work including the maintenance of accurate and detailed files and records; verify accuracy of information, research discrepancies and record information.
  • Prepare monthly permit reports; enter a variety of data and information into various computer programs.
  • Operate a variety of office equipment including telephones, computers, copy machines and facsimile machines; input and retrieve data and text. Communicate on a two-way radio with inspectors and other city personnel.
